What are parallel lines?

Back

Parallel lines are lines in a plane that never meet or intersect, no matter how far they are extended.

What is a transversal?

Back

A transversal is a line that crosses at least two other lines in the same plane.

What are corresponding angles?

Back

Corresponding angles are pairs of angles that are in similar positions at each intersection where a transversal crosses two lines.

What are alternate interior angles?

Back

Alternate interior angles are pairs of angles that lie between two lines and on opposite sides of a transversal.

What are supplementary angles?

Back

Supplementary angles are two angles whose measures add up to 180 degrees.
